West Kelowna Fireplace Rescue responds to grass hearth behind Walmart on Louie Drive
At 11:39 am today, West Kelowna Fire Rescue was alerted of a rapidly spreading grass fire behind the Walmart on Louie Drive.
When the 16 personnel and five fire trucks arrived on location, they discovered that the fire was spreading quickly in the dry grass uphill towards homes.
The fire rescue team’s primary objective was to stop the fire before it reached the numerous residences close by.
They successfully stopped the fire and no homes were damaged and no injuries were reported.
The crew worked hard under the demanding, hot conditions. The fire is now out and a fire guard is being constructed in the area.
The cause of this fire is suspicious and was likely human caused. The RCMP is investigating.
With the extreme heatwave settling in for the next week, WKFR is urging the public to remain vigilant and report any fire suspicions immediately.
